Summary:

Corporate social responsibility (CSR) offers an important strategic tool for enhancing firms’s competitive advantage and legitimacy. With an application of stakeholder theory, this study considers how multiple dimensions of CSR might affect global brand value differently, as well as the potential impact of firm size on the relationships of diverse CSR activities with global brand value. As its primary contribution to extant literature, this article establishes how a firm’s involvement in diverse CSR activities can influence its global brand value, according to its primary stakeholders’s perspectives, on the basis of cross-country, cross-industry data sets reflecting 144 global brands across 17 countries.
